About West View Healthy Living

+
West View Healthy Living is a nonprofit skilled nursing community located along Mechanicsburg Road in Wooster, Ohio, offering a values-driven approach to post-acute and long-term care for seniors in Wayne County. Guided by a nonprofit mission rather than financial returns, West View channels its resources directly into resident care, staffing, and the quality of the living environment — a distinction that families navigating senior care decisions consistently find meaningful. Mechanicsburg Road runs through the western reaches of Wooster, providing residents with a setting that balances accessibility to city amenities with a quieter, more residential atmosphere. Cleveland Clinic Wooster on Beall Avenue — one of the region's most trusted and comprehensive hospital systems — is the primary clinical partner for care transitions, offering emergency services, specialty medicine, and seamless coordination with skilled nursing facilities. Aultman Wooster on Grant Street provides additional medical resources close by. The Mechanicsburg Road location offers families convenient access to Wooster's western side, with grocery options including Buehler's Fresh Foods and the Giant Eagle and Walmart Supercenter on Burbank Road all within a short drive. Wooster's downtown Liberty Street district, featuring the Wayne County Public Library, local restaurants, and boutique shopping, is easily reachable for families who want to extend their visits into the community. Wooster Memorial Park's walking paths and green space offer an inviting outdoor option for residents with mobility and for family gatherings in warmer months. As a nonprofit organization, West View Healthy Living draws staff who are drawn to mission-driven work — caregivers who choose this setting because they believe in the organization's purpose. The result is often lower turnover, deeper resident-staff relationships, and a culture where residents are known as individuals with histories, preferences, and goals rather than as clinical cases. West View's commitment to healthy living is embedded in its name and expressed daily through programming, nutrition, and compassionate engagement with every person in its care.

What does it mean that West View Healthy Living is a nonprofit facility? +

As a nonprofit, West View Healthy Living reinvests its operating surplus back into care quality, staffing, and community programs rather than distributing profits to shareholders. This often results in a mission-focused culture, staff who are drawn to purpose-driven work, and a stronger emphasis on resident dignity and individualized attention. Families frequently find nonprofit facilities to be more stable and community-rooted than corporate alternatives.

What care services does West View Healthy Living offer? +

West View Healthy Living provides skilled nursing care, which includes both short-term rehabilitation for those recovering from surgeries, strokes, or illness, and long-term residential nursing care for seniors who require ongoing clinical support. Rehabilitative therapy services — physical, occupational, and speech — are typically a core part of the post-acute program. Call (330) 264-8640 for current program details.
